10.0We were staying in another hotel at the far edge of Portsmouth (without a vehicle) and changed our lodging for our final night in town. We changed it, chiefly because we wanted to be closer to the center of town, for sight-seeing, dining, etc.. This was a good move. Because of the central location of the Bow Hotel, on the last night in town, we got to walk across the bridge to Maine for dinner and had a more relaxed breakfast on the morning of our departure than we otherwise would have.
− Geez, this place was expensive. I'm wondering why there seems to be so little middle-ground in places like Portsmouth, between the Travelodge and the Days Inn (or equivalent) up by Rte 95, on one hand, and the boutique-y Bow Hotel in the center of town, on the other. We enjoyed the Bow Hotel's amenities--beautifully appointed, fastidiously maintained room--and so on. But the location convenience really prompted our choice to switch hotels, and we would likely have chosen a hostel or whatnot if readily available. Also, it would have been nicer to interact with a human at the desk than it was to deal with staff remotely on the phone throughout our stay.

Please note, complimentary bicycle rentals are subject to availability.
We have seven parking spaces available to reserve for $35 per night; subject to availability. Please call to reserve one of these parking spots.Guests are required to show a photo ID and credit card upon check-in.
